网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ios云打包提上传到app

iOS云打包是一种将iOS应用程序(IPA文件)上传到云端进行打包和签名的服务。它的主要目的是为了简化和加速应用程序的发布流程,并提供更方便的方式来共享和分发应用程序。下面将详细介绍iOS云打包的原理和步骤。

1. 原理:

iOS云打包的原理是将开发者提供的源代码或IPA文件上传到云端服务器,然后在服务器端进行编译、打包和签名操作,最后生成一个可安装的IPA文件并返回给开发者或用户。

2. 步骤:

以下是使用iOS云打包的典型步骤:

(1)准备工作:开发者需要准备好源代码、开发者证书、描述文件等必要的开发工具和材料。

(2)上传代码:开发者将源代码或已经打包的IPA文件上传到云端服务器。

(3)选择配置:开发者可以选择不同的配置选项,例如选择需要的iOS SDK版本、应用程序的ID、图标和启动画面等。

(4)编译打包:服务器根据开发者提供的配置选项,在服务器端进行编译和打包操作,生成一个新的IPA文件。

(5)应用签名:服务器使用开发者的证书和私钥对应用程序进行签名,确保应用程序可以在iOS设备上安装和运行。

(6)下载结果:服务器生成的IPA文件会被返回给开发者或用户,可以通过下载链接或邮件附件的方式获取。

(7)安装应用:开发者或用户得到IPA文件后,可以通过iTunes或iOS设备上的安装工具进行安装。

3. 优势:

使用iOS云打包有以下几个优势:

(1)快速便捷:云打包服务可以加速应用程序的发布流程,减少繁琐的本地打包操作。

(2)避免配置问题:云端环境可以自动配置所需的开发环境和工具,避免了本地环境配置问题。

(3)支持远程协作:开发团队可以远程协作共享代码和打包结果,提高工作效率和协同开发能力。

(4)节省资源:使用云端服务器进行打包,可以节省本地计算资源和存储空间。

4. 注意事项:

在使用iOS云打包时,需要注意以下几点:

(1)安全性:确保选择可信的云打包服务提供商,保护应用程序的源代码和开发者证书等敏感信息。

(2)隐私问题:云打包服务可能需要获取开发者的账户权限,开发者需要评估服务提供商的隐私政策和数据保护措施。

(3)费用和限制:不同的云打包服务可能有不同的收费模式和使用限制,开发者需要了解清楚并选择适合自己需求的服务。

总结:

iOS云打包是一种方便快捷的应用程序打包和签名服务,可以简化应用发布流程,提高开发效率。通过理解其原理和使用步骤,开发者可以更好地利用这一工具,加速应用程序的开发和推广。


相关知识:
ios打包签名哪个好
iOS打包签名是指将开发者编写的iOS应用程序打包成可供安装的.ipa文件,并且对该文件进行数字签名以保证应用的安全性和可信度。在iOS开发中,打包签名是非常重要的一步,也是必需的过程。iOS打包签名的原理是通过使用开发者的证书和相关私钥来对应用进行签名,
2023-07-28
ios程序发布测试之打包发布
在iOS开发中,发布测试版本的应用程序是非常重要的一步。发布测试版本可以让开发者在真机环境下进行测试,提前发现并解决潜在的问题。本文将详细介绍iOS程序发布测试的打包发布过程。1. 创建证书和配置文件在发布iOS应用之前,首先需要创建开发者证书和配置文件。
2023-07-28
ios修改并打包出客户端
iOS修改并打包出客户端的过程可以简单分为以下几个步骤:1. 获取项目源代码:首先,你需要获得需要修改的iOS项目的源代码。你可以通过向项目开发者索要或者从版本控制系统(如Git)中获取。确保你获得的是完整的项目代码,包括相关配置文件、资源文件等。2. 安
2023-07-28
ios如何打包
iOS开发中,打包是将应用程序打包成IPA文件的过程。IPA文件是可以在iOS设备上安装和运行的应用程序包。下面是iOS打包的详细介绍。1. 创建打包配置文件:在Xcode中,选择项目的工程文件,然后选择TARGETS,选择Build Settings,找
2023-07-28
ios上打包deb
iOS上打包deb文件的过程实际上是将应用程序的源代码和资源文件打包成一个.deb文件,然后可以通过Cydia等工具安装在越狱设备上。下面将详细介绍iOS上打包deb的具体步骤。1. 准备环境首先,我们需要在电脑上安装好iOS开发环境,包括Xcode、iO
2023-07-28
h5打包iosapp
H5(HTML5)是一种用于构建跨平台应用程序的技术,而iOS是苹果公司的移动操作系统。将 H5 打包成 iOS App 是一种将基于 Web 的应用程序封装成可以在 iOS 设备上运行的原生应用程序的方法。本文将详细介绍 H5 打包 iOS App 的原
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号